If you are building, make sure to ask your builder if they do include a shelf in their bathroom bid. In this house, they have a travertine stone paver shelf. Sometimes when building there are so many details its hard to remember certain things.






We try to be as thorough as we can to make sure you get what you want in your home and nothing important is left out. Also, if you are planning on having a pedestal sink in your bathrooms, that is something you need to tell the builder early in the plans to plan for plumbing.

The luxurious master bath is a beautiful addition to this room. Using large tiles not only makes the tub seem larger, but it reduces the amount of grout lines that need to be cleaned.


The decorative strip is a glass mosaic with natural stone accents throughout. This adds a nice finishing touch to the tub surround.






A graceful brushed nickel faucet creates a calming effect that echoes the purpose of the large tub. The large stone pattern on this porcelain tile mimics the look of a rich natural travertine stone.









In the master shower, the same large tiles are used. Notice they are placed in a square lay instead of an offset brick pattern. This looks slightly more modern than the traditional offset pattern.







Breaking up the large porcelain wall tiles, the shower has two travertine stone shampoo shelves in the corner. On the shower floor is 4x4" tumbled travertine stone tiles. The variation of size in tiles helps this area of the bathroom look more custom. This grout color complimented the stone and tile quite nicely. Just for reference, is a Noce travertine stone with fawn colored grout.
